Slicked-back look, structured hairstyle, wet look, highlighted strands – choosing your style according to your mood and desires, and no longer according to your hair type, is possible! You just need to choose THE right styling product.

A few years ago, we only knew about hairspray and its "helmet" effect. Thanks to advances in hair research, new resin qualities no longer leave white residue when drying, and other styling products have emerged.

Gels, sprays, mousses, waxes, pastes, fluids, and milks are not just styling products; they are also care products!

HAIRSPRAYS

This "old lady" of styling products has been revamped: no more sticky veil that dried out and stiffened hair. Now, new hairsprays ensure natural hold, thanks to their extremely fine resins, your hairstyle has staying power and retains its lightness.

These new hairsprays are not just for holding; enriched with proteins, they also protect your hair from humidity, sun rays, and light.

Their texture is removed by brushing, without leaving any residue.

SPRAYS

Whether they are setting, styling, root-lifting, or gloss (for shine), they are there to satisfy you and help you achieve a well-styled look. Very easy to use, they are sprayed like a hairspray, before being distributed with the fingers according to the desired effect:

To get volume, we invite you to spray the product on the roots of your hair.

If you want to achieve shine, spray it all over your hair.

Sprays contain more or less alcohol (necessary for resin dilution) depending on whether the hold is strong or extra-strong.

Don't worry, to neutralize its effects on the hair, care ingredients (trace elements, vitamins, amino acids) are added.

But if your hair is very dry, it's better to use another styling product, such as wax or gel.

GELS

Gels are construction and creation products. Give free rein to your wildest ideas!

Spiky hair, bandeau strands, structured hairstyle – you design your hairstyle with your fingers. New gels, enriched with silicone, structure the hair without making it wet. Moreover, they don't stick to your fingers and are easily removed by brushing or shampooing.

This is the styling product you need if you're going for a styled/un-styled look and a "wet" effect.

WAXES AND MOLDING PASTES

Excellent molding products, they allow you to work hair strand by strand. Waxes and pastes are light and non-greasy; they add texture to your hair while protecting it from dehydration thanks to their mineral complex and vitamins.

You can adopt a different look with the same haircut:

Curly strands, spiky strands, slicked-back strands.

To apply:

  • either on wet hair for ideal styling
  • or on dry hair to sculpt the hair
  • if your hair is dry and already styled, a dab of wax will make it shinier.

Our hair stylist advisors recommend warming the product a little between your hands before applying it, this makes it more fluid.

Be careful, fine and limp hair does not like the texture of wax. Prefer mousses for them.

MOUSSES

This is the ideal styling product for fine hair because they are light and do not weigh down the hair. On the contrary, they restore volume and tone to the hair by coating it with protective fibers. The hair cuticles are tightened, giving it "body." Your hair is easier to detangle.

Your hairstyle has volume while remaining natural.

For an even more sheathing effect: add a dab of styling gel to your volumizing mousse, mix well in the palm of your hand, then apply.
